Skip to content

[FD-49345] Want to keep receiving expired license report *after* the license has expired #17422

@uberbrady

Description

@uberbrady

We might want to also consider this for expired assets, too.

Customer sometimes has licenses that have fully expired, but they want to keep being reminded that the license needs to be renewed, even after it expires.

There are a few ways of doing this of differing difficulties.

  • We can add a command-line parameter to the artisan script that changes some of the behavior
  • We can add a setting that says for how long after a license has expired (and/or an asset Warranty?) that we should keep sending notifications. Maybe set to null for "forever" and 0 for "never". (When created, set the default to 'zero' to keep the existing functionality).
  • We can add a .env var that sets how long after expiration that we should keep alerting
  • We can make it always do that - you have to delete the license (or "something"?) to make it stop pestering you.

Honestly, as I'm listing out the options, number two seems like the best user-experience, at the cost of having to add yet another setting to the settings table.

Metadata

Metadata

Assignees

Projects

Status

No status

Relationships

None yet

Development

No branches or pull requests

Issue actions